> We already have the option to attach a callback to an interrupt
> to retrieve its pending state. As we are planning to expand this
> facility, move this callback into its own data structure.
>
> This will limit the size of individual interrupts as the ops
> structures can be shared across multiple interrupts.

As I replied to Sasha earlier, I don't see a good reason to backport
this, as it doesn't improve anything on its own. Unless there is a
compelling reason to get this backported, I'd rather see it dropped.
